1. Louvre Museum, Paris

The Louvre Museum in Paris, France is one of the most famous museums in the world. The museum holds more than 35,000 works of art and artifacts, including the Mona Lisa, the Winged Victory of Samothrace, and the Venus de Milo. The Louvre is also known for its magnificent architecture, including the iconic glass pyramid built by I.M. Pei design. 2. British Museum, London

The British Museum in London, England is a vast institution containing over 8 million objects, making it one of the largest museums in the world. The museum’s collection covers the history of human civilization, from prehistory to the present day. Some of the most famous objects in the British Museum include the Rosetta Stone, the Parthenon sculpture, and the Elgin Marble. The museum attracts more than 6 million visitors each year and is a symbol of British cultural heritage.

3.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York

The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York is one of the most popular museums in the United States, attracting more than 7 million visitors each year. The museum houses an extensive collection of art and artifacts from around the world, including works by Rembrandt, Van Gogh, and Monet. The museum also hosts exhibitions and special events, making it a vibrant cultural hub in the heart of New York.

5. National Palace Museum, Taipei

The National Palace Museum in Taipei, Taiwan is a museum that houses an extensive collection of Chinese artifacts and works, including paintings, calligraphy, ceramics, and jade. The museum’s collection is considered one of the finest in the world and includes many important works dating from the Tang, Song, and Ming dynasties. The museum attracts more than 5 million visitors every year and is a symbol of China’s cultural heritage.
